ducksoup 02-05-2015 09:33 AM

Way to much money for that knife! Same as the Pendelton Hunter except for the fancy handle and street price for the Pendelton Hunter is about $60. $500 buys you a very nice custom custom knife where you get to choose the handle material and color, what kind of attachment pins are used to put the handle on and even what kind of steel it's made out of. Do a google search for custom knife makers, you'll be amazed at the work some of these guys do, and for under $500 too!
